Why Team Building Activities Are Essential for JavaScript Development Teams in eCommerce
In today’s fast-paced eCommerce environment, JavaScript development teams face mounting pressure to deliver seamless user experiences and robust features quickly. Team building activities are not just breaks from coding—they are strategic investments that enhance productivity, improve collaboration, and foster innovation. When developers work cohesively, communication becomes clearer, problem-solving more creative, and morale significantly higher. These factors directly translate into a competitive advantage for your eCommerce platform.
Key Benefits of Team Building for JavaScript eCommerce Teams
- Improved Communication: Streamlined dialogue reduces bugs and accelerates development cycles.
- Enhanced Problem-Solving: Collaborative approaches lead to faster debugging and innovative solutions.
- Higher Morale: Engaged teams experience lower turnover and stronger commitment.
- Increased Innovation: Diverse perspectives fuel inventive features that differentiate your brand.
Ignoring team building risks siloed workflows, miscommunication, and slower releases—ultimately hindering your platform’s ability to compete effectively.
What Are Team Building Activities? A Practical Definition for Developers
Team building activities are structured exercises designed to strengthen interpersonal relationships, communication, and cooperation within a team. For JavaScript developers, these activities often emphasize collaborative coding, problem-solving sessions, and social interactions that accommodate virtual or hybrid work environments.
Core Characteristics of Team Building Activities
- Can be virtual or in-person
- Range from skill-based challenges to social bonding events
- Vary in length from daily rituals to extended workshops
The ultimate goal is cultivating a motivated team culture where members feel connected and aligned with shared objectives—critical for delivering high-quality eCommerce solutions.
Proven Virtual Team Building Activities for JavaScript Developers in eCommerce
Here are six effective virtual team building activities tailored to JavaScript eCommerce teams, complete with implementation guidance and expected business outcomes.
1. Virtual Pair Programming Sessions: Boost Code Quality and Knowledge Sharing
Pair programming pairs two developers to work on the same code simultaneously, promoting immediate feedback and knowledge transfer.
Why it works: Improves code quality, accelerates learning—especially between junior and senior developers—and reduces bugs.
Implementation Steps:
- Schedule 1-2 hour sessions weekly to build momentum.
- Use tools like Visual Studio Live Share or CodeSandbox for seamless collaboration.
- Rotate partners regularly to diversify knowledge sharing.
- Set clear objectives, such as refactoring checkout modules or debugging critical issues.
Example: ShopEase’s weekly pair programming reduced checkout bugs by 40% within three months.
2. Code Challenge Competitions: Sharpen Skills Through Friendly Competition
Organize contests where developers solve JavaScript puzzles or optimize eCommerce functionalities under time constraints.
Why it works: Encourages creative problem-solving, hones coding skills, and injects fun into routine work.
Implementation Steps:
- Use platforms like LeetCode, HackerRank, or create custom internal challenges.
- Define clear rules: time limits, difficulty levels, and scoring criteria.
- Offer incentives such as gift cards or public recognition.
- Host review sessions to discuss different approaches and lessons learned.
Outcome: CartBoost’s monthly challenges improved site speed by 15%, enhancing customer satisfaction.
3. Virtual Coffee Chats and Social Hours: Combat Remote Isolation
Informal video calls encourage team members to bond over shared interests beyond work.
Why it works: Builds trust, reduces isolation, and fosters a supportive team culture.
Implementation Steps:
- Schedule 30-minute sessions once or twice weekly.
- Use breakout rooms for larger teams to facilitate intimate conversations.
- Provide conversation starters or icebreaker games.
- Keep participation voluntary to maintain authenticity.
4. Collaborative Project Sprints: Foster Ownership and Cross-Functional Learning
Run focused mini-projects on non-critical but impactful features like UI animations or accessibility improvements.
Why it works: Encourages collaboration, ownership, and skill development across experience levels.
Implementation Steps:
- Select projects that add value without risking critical systems.
- Form diverse teams mixing juniors, seniors, and other roles.
- Set sprint durations of 1-2 weeks.
- Track progress transparently using Jira, Trello, or GitHub Projects.
- Present demos to celebrate outcomes and gather feedback.
5. Retrospective Workshops with Actionable Feedback: Drive Continuous Improvement
Regular retrospectives create space for open dialogue and process refinement.
Why it works: Empowers teams to identify pain points and evolve workflows effectively.
Implementation Steps:
- Schedule retrospectives after each sprint or release.
- Use structured formats like Start-Stop-Continue or 4Ls (Liked, Learned, Lacked, Longed for).
- Foster psychological safety to encourage honest, blame-free communication.
- Assign and track action items to ensure follow-through.
6. Cross-Functional Hackathons: Spark Innovation Across Departments
Bring together developers, designers, marketers, and support staff to co-create innovative eCommerce features.
Why it works: Builds empathy, aligns teams on business goals, and accelerates innovation.
Implementation Steps:
- Choose a business-aligned theme (e.g., improving conversion rates).
- Invite diverse participants from multiple departments.
- Set a focused timeframe of 24-48 hours.
- Provide access to APIs, datasets, and collaboration tools.
- Evaluate projects with a panel and reward top innovations.
Example: Trendify’s hackathon produced a recommendation engine prototype that increased click-through rates by 10%.
Gathering Feedback to Optimize Team Building Efforts
Validating the impact of team building activities through continuous feedback is essential. Tools like Typeform, SurveyMonkey, and platforms such as Zigpoll enable you to capture real-time insights from participants. For example, quick pulse surveys after retrospectives or virtual coffee chats can reveal morale trends and highlight areas for improvement.
Combining usage analytics with direct feedback enhances measurement accuracy. Platforms like Zigpoll integrate seamlessly with existing workflows, providing nuanced customer and team insights. This ongoing feedback loop supports data-driven decisions to refine your team building strategies and maximize their impact on development outcomes.
Measuring the Impact of Team Building Activities: Key Metrics and Tools
| Activity | Key Metrics | Measurement Tools |
|---|---|---|
| Virtual Pair Programming | Session count, bug reduction, resolution time | Jira, Visual Studio Live Share logs |
| Code Challenge Competitions | Participation, problem-solving speed, skill growth | LeetCode/HackerRank dashboards, surveys |
| Virtual Coffee Chats | Attendance, team morale, engagement scores | Pulse surveys (e.g., Zigpoll), Zoom reports |
| Collaborative Project Sprints | Completion rates, code quality, time-to-market | GitHub commits, code review tools, Jira |
| Retrospective Workshops | Action items completed, sprint velocity, satisfaction | Retrospective tools (Miro, Retrium), surveys |
| Cross-Functional Hackathons | Participant count, prototype delivery, feature adoption | Project management tools, business KPIs |
Regularly tracking these metrics validates the ROI of your team building initiatives and guides data-informed adjustments.
Recommended Tools to Elevate Team Building and Collaboration
| Activity | Recommended Tools | Key Features | Pricing Model |
|---|---|---|---|
| Virtual Pair Programming | Visual Studio Live Share, CodeSandbox, Tuple | Real-time coding, debugging, voice chat | Free & Paid tiers |
| Code Challenge Competitions | LeetCode, HackerRank, Codewars | Custom challenges, leaderboards | Freemium |
| Virtual Coffee Chats | Zoom, Microsoft Teams, Gather | Video conferencing, breakout rooms | Subscription-based |
| Collaborative Project Sprints | Jira, Trello, GitHub Projects | Sprint planning, task tracking | Freemium & Paid versions |
| Retrospective Workshops | Retrium, Miro, FunRetro | Templates, feedback collection | Subscription |
| Cross-Functional Hackathons | Slack, Discord, Google Meet | Messaging, file sharing, video calls | Mostly free & paid add-ons |
Integrating feedback platforms like Zigpoll alongside these tools enhances your ability to gather actionable insights seamlessly.
Prioritizing Team Building Initiatives: A Practical Checklist for JavaScript eCommerce Teams
- Diagnose current team challenges and communication gaps.
- Align activities with specific business goals (e.g., reduce bugs, improve velocity).
- Start with low-effort, high-impact activities like virtual coffee chats.
- Incorporate pair programming for mentoring and knowledge sharing.
- Schedule regular retrospectives to monitor progress.
- Gradually introduce competitions to boost engagement.
- Plan cross-functional hackathons quarterly to spark innovation.
- Use tools like Zigpoll to continuously gather team feedback.
- Track metrics and adjust activities based on outcomes.
Step-by-Step Guide to Launching Team Building Activities in Your eCommerce JavaScript Team
- Define Clear Objectives: Prioritize goals such as faster releases, better code quality, or higher team morale.
- Select Starter Activities: Begin with virtual coffee chats and pair programming for quick wins.
- Establish a Consistent Schedule: Recurring sessions build routine and set expectations.
- Communicate Benefits: Share how these activities support personal growth and business success.
- Leverage Collaboration and Feedback Tools: Use Visual Studio Live Share, Jira, and platforms like Zigpoll to streamline workflows.
- Collect and Analyze Feedback: Use surveys from tools like Zigpoll after each session to gather insights.
- Iterate and Expand: Introduce code challenges, retrospectives, and hackathons as engagement grows.
- Celebrate Successes: Publicly recognize achievements to reinforce positive behaviors.
FAQ: Your Questions About Virtual Team Building for JavaScript eCommerce Teams
What are some effective virtual team building activities for a JavaScript development team working on an eCommerce platform?
Effective activities include virtual pair programming, code challenge competitions, collaborative project sprints, virtual coffee chats, retrospectives, and cross-functional hackathons tailored to eCommerce challenges.
How often should team building activities be scheduled for remote development teams?
A balanced cadence works best: weekly informal coffee chats, bi-weekly pair programming, and monthly or quarterly larger events like hackathons and retrospectives.
How can I measure the impact of team building activities on my eCommerce development team?
Track metrics such as bug reduction, sprint velocity, participation rates, team satisfaction scores, and feature delivery timelines using project management tools (Jira, GitHub) and survey platforms like Zigpoll.
What tools are best for facilitating remote team building activities?
Visual Studio Live Share, LeetCode, Zoom, Jira, Miro, and platforms like Zigpoll offer comprehensive support for coding collaboration, challenges, communication, task management, retrospectives, and feedback collection.
How do I encourage participation in team building activities without making it feel mandatory?
Maintain transparency about benefits, keep activities enjoyable and optional, offer incentives, and foster a culture that values collaboration and continuous learning.
Expected Outcomes from Implementing Targeted Team Building Activities
- 30-50% reduction in development bugs through improved collaboration and pair programming.
- 20-40% faster sprint completion by enhancing communication and workflow clarity.
- 15-25% increase in employee engagement scores, reducing turnover.
- Innovation gains demonstrated by new features developed during hackathons that improve conversion rates.
- Stronger cross-departmental alignment around business goals.
- Elevated code quality via peer reviews and shared best practices.
By integrating these targeted, measurable team building activities, JavaScript development teams can deliver higher-quality eCommerce products faster while nurturing a collaborative and innovative work environment—whether remote or hybrid. Leveraging feedback tools like Zigpoll empowers leaders to continuously adapt initiatives based on real-time team insights, ensuring sustained success and a thriving developer culture.